roon wrote: |
Mini-rant: It's actually a bit irritating seeing so many people flocking to this show JUST BECAUSE one character is potentially a lesbian (or basically feels something for another girl). Sure, it hasn't been touched upon before so it's controversial... but for a bunch of lesbians to flock to it just for that is really disappointing. Restricting themselves to their own label, perhaps? |
I find this post offensive. Lesbians "flock" to this show because they're so desperate for representation. Tell me, what other "lesbian" show would they be watching? Cant think of one? Thats because there are none.
Lesbians are a minority that are hardly recognized by the media. ESPECIALLY in Japan. And when they are, its usually a disappointing stereotype or simply played up to boost the ratings among horny teenage boys.
So when a show comes along that at least tries to be honest in its portrayal of a lesbian character, an doesn't trivialize her, when she's written as an honest to god human being like any other character, its a BIG deal. Lesbians are "flocking" to last friends not simply because of the lesbian character, but because its a GOOD lesbian character. Which is far rarer than you probably ever considered.
What was your reason for watching this show. A fan of Ueno's? Masami? Ryo? Was is randomly recommended to you? Clearly those are better reasons to pick up a new show. </sarcasm>
I'm sorry you're so irritated by a minority expressing their surprised delight at not being trivialized and ignored for once.
